#e00f03 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e00f03 is composed of 87.8% red, 5.9%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 3.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 44.5%. #e00f03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1e06 with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

Shades and Tints of #e00f03

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0100 is the darkest color, while #fff7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e00f03

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776c6c is the less saturated color, while #e00f03 is the most saturated one.
